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Creamy Coconut White Fish Stew
Step 1: Prepare the Fish
Rinse the white fish fillets under cold water and pat them dry with a paper towel. Cut the fish into bite-sized pieces and season them generously with salt and pepper. This ensures that each piece of fish will absorb all the delicious flavors as the Creamy Coconut White Fish Stew cooks.
Step 2: Sauté the Aromatics
In a large pot, heat a tablespoon of oil over medium heat. Add the chopped onion and sauté for about 5 minutes until it becomes transparent and fragrant. Stir occasionally to prevent burning, creating a flavorful base for your stew that will elevate all the other ingredients beautifully.
Step 3: Add Garlic and Ginger
Once the onions are softened, it’s time to add minced garlic and grated ginger to the pot. Cook everything together for an additional 1-2 minutes, stirring continuously until the garlic is aromatic and slightly golden. This step allows the ginger and garlic to infuse their warm flavors into your Creamy Coconut White Fish Stew.
Step 4: Incorporate Veggies
Next, stir in the diced tomatoes and chopped bell pepper, allowing the mixture to cook for 5-7 minutes until the veggies soften and release their juices. The vibrant color and texture will enhance not only the visual appeal but also the wholesome goodness of your stew.
Step 5: Create the Broth
Pour in the rich coconut milk and your choice of vegetable or chicken broth, stirring gently to combine. Bring the mixture to a gentle simmer over medium heat and let it bubble for about 5 minutes. This will meld all the flavors together beautifully, creating a fragrant and creamy base for the stew.
Step 6: Flavor Boost
Add a splash of fish sauce, fresh lime juice, and curry powder into the simmering pot. Stir well to combine and taste, adjusting with salt and pepper as needed. The Creamy Coconut White Fish Stew will gain a delicious depth of flavor, bringing the essence of the tropics to your kitchen.
Step 7: Cook the Fish
Gently add the seasoned fish pieces into the simmering broth, taking care to space them out evenly. Let the fish cook for about 10 minutes until it becomes opaque and flakes easily with a fork. This step is crucial for ensuring that your fish remains tender and infused with the stew’s luscious flavors.
Step 8: Add Greens
After the fish is cooked, fold in the chopped spinach or kale, stirring gently for about 2-3 minutes until the greens are wilted but still vibrant. This final addition not only boosts nutrition but also adds a lovely splash of color to your Creamy Coconut White Fish Stew.
Step 9: Serve and Garnish
Remove the pot from heat and ladle the aromatic stew into bowls. Garnish each serving with freshly chopped cilantro for a burst of freshness. The rich aroma of your Creamy Coconut White Fish Stew is now ready to be enjoyed by your family!
Step 10: Add Lime Wedges
Serve the stew hot, accompanied by lime wedges on the side. This allows everyone to squeeze an added burst of zesty flavor over their bowl, enhancing the delightful experience of your Creamy Coconut White Fish Stew.

How to Store and Freeze Creamy Coconut White Fish Stew
Fridge: Store leftover Creamy Coconut White Fish Stew in an airtight container for up to 3 days. Make sure to cool it to room temperature before sealing to maintain quality.
Freezer: If you want to freeze the stew, place it in a freezer-safe container. It can be stored for up to 3 months. Just be sure to leave some space at the top for expansion.
Reheating: To reheat, thaw overnight in the fridge if frozen, then gently warm on the stovetop over low heat until heated through. Stir occasionally to ensure even heating and prevent the fish from overcooking.
Tip: If storing for more than a day, consider leaving out delicate ingredients like spinach or cilantro until you’re ready to enjoy the stew for the best taste and texture!

Creamy Coconut White Fish Stew Recipe FAQs
Can I use frozen white fish fillets for the stew?
Absolutely! Frozen white fish fillets are a convenient option. Just make sure to thaw them completely in the refrigerator overnight before use. This ensures even cooking and helps maintain the stew’s rich flavor and texture.
How should I store leftovers of Creamy Coconut White Fish Stew?
Leftover Creamy Coconut White Fish Stew can be stored in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. Be sure to let it cool to room temperature before sealing to ensure optimum freshness. When reheating, do so gently on the stovetop to maintain the integrity of the fish.
Can I freeze Creamy Coconut White Fish Stew?
Yes! To freeze, place the stew in a freezer-safe container and store it for up to 3 months. Be sure to leave some space at the top of the container as the stew will expand when frozen. Thaw it overnight in the refrigerator before reheating for the best results.
What should I do if the stew is too thick after reheating?
If your Creamy Coconut White Fish Stew is too thick upon reheating, simply add a splash of vegetable or chicken broth, stir well, and heat over low until it reaches your desired consistency. This will revive the silky texture while enhancing the flavor.
Are there any dietary considerations for this recipe regarding allergies?
While this stew is gluten-free and packed with wholesome ingredients, it’s important to consider individual allergies. The recipe includes fish sauce and coconut milk, which some may be sensitive to. If cooking for someone with dietary restrictions, feel free to adjust the ingredients, using alternatives like soy sauce for a gluten-free option.
How can I tell when the fish is cooked perfectly in the stew?
To ensure your fish is perfectly cooked, look for it to become opaque and easily flake with a fork. This should take about 10 minutes in the stew. To avoid overcooking, you can start checking a minute or two early, ensuring it remains moist and tender.
